> On Thu, Jan 22, 2026 at 08:33:04PM +0800, Felix Gu wrote:
> > In vexpress_syscfg_probe(), of_parse_phandle() is called inside a loop
> > but the returned device_node reference is never released.
> > Fix this by using the __free(device_node) cleanup handler to automatically
> > release the reference when the variable goes out of scope.
> >
> > Fixes: a5a38765ac79b ("bus: vexpress-config: simplify config bus probing")
> > Signed-off-by: Felix Gu <ustc.gu@...il.com>
> > ---
> >  drivers/bus/vexpress-config.c | 6 +++---
> >  1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)
> >
> > diff --git a/drivers/bus/vexpress-config.c b/drivers/bus/vexpress-config.c
> > index 64ee920721ee..a1fa583e9f5d 100644
> > --- a/drivers/bus/vexpress-config.c
> > +++ b/drivers/bus/vexpress-config.c
> > @@ -4,6 +4,7 @@
> >   * Copyright (C) 2014 ARM Limited
> >   */
> >
> > +#include <linux/cleanup.h>
>
> Not sure this is needed. of.h includes cleanup.h, so we don't run the risk of
> not getting the cleanup macros defined.
>
> >  #include <linux/err.h>
> >  #include <linux/init.h>
> >  #include <linux/io.h>
> > @@ -390,9 +391,8 @@ static int vexpress_syscfg_probe(struct platform_device *pdev)
> >       }
> >
> >       for_each_compatible_node(node, NULL, "arm,vexpress,config-bus") {
> > -             struct device_node *bridge_np;
> > -
> > -             bridge_np = of_parse_phandle(node, "arm,vexpress,config-bridge", 0);
> > +             struct device_node *bridge_np __free(device_node) =
> > +                     of_parse_phandle(node, "arm,vexpress,config-bridge", 0);
> >               if (bridge_np != pdev->dev.parent->of_node)
> >                       continue;
> >
